Use split view to place two apps side by side with green button and resize divider; mission control shows all windows and desktops, while app expose shows only the current app.
Create smart folders, or saved searches, to view files by name, type, or other criteria. Add them to the sidebar for quick access, with auto-updating results as new files appear.
Learn to set and switch default apps for file types on macOS by using open with, drag and drop, and get info to apply always or across all files.

Safari 14's privacy report shows how cross-site tracking is blocked and lists trackers across sites. Turn on prevent cross-site tracking to keep ads non-targeted and regain privacy control.
